Frequently asked questions

Is $50K a good salary in Irvine?

At $50K/year in Irvine, your estimated monthly take-home is $2,773. With 1BR rent around $2,800/month, rent takes up 101% of your take-home. That's considered difficult.

Is $50K a good salary in Fort Wayne?

At $50K/year in Fort Wayne, your estimated monthly take-home is $3,027. With 1BR rent around $1,000/month, rent takes up 33% of your take-home. That's considered manageable.

Which city is more affordable on a $50K salary?

Fort Wayne leaves you with more money after core expenses โ€” $1,419/month vs $-764/month in Irvine.

Can I afford to live alone in Irvine on $50K?

It's tight. Rent in Irvine would take 101% of your $50K take-home pay. You may need to find roommates or look at studios to stay within the 30% rule.
